Transaction a89833101ae110e31e25bdf10f92ac7718363ed35a676a93051dc9b2a6253852
1 Input
1 Output
-
a89833101ae110e31e25bdf10f92ac7718363ed35a676a93051dc9b2a6253852:0
- value
- 267547
- script pubkey
- OP_0 OP_PUSHBYTES_20 84cfdc8e3b6d644eed94bb68ac5f323af4baa827
- address
- bc1qsn8aer3md4jyamv5hd52chej8t6t42p8k7fjhz